The Degeneration and Rebuilding of University Spirit
Wang Min-sheng
Abstract
Wang Min-sheng
Abstract
University spirit is the lifeblood and soul of university.And university spirit is a kind of spiritual trait which is deposited during historical development.University spirit is a distinguished collective conscious,idea and valuable spiritual legacy.University spirit means the combination of scientific spirit and humane spirit.University spirit contains an independent,detached,critical and creative style.And university spirit also means freedom and magnanimous.But for a veriety of reasons,we are losing our university spirit.University is degenerating,losing its independence,and becoming utilitarian.University spirit coincides with the spirit of intellectuals.We should constructing mutual spirit of university and intellectuals.
